California section 8 housing new law. An estimated 300 000 low income californians rely on state and federal housing vouchers. A new state law aims to address that by banning landlords from denying potential tenants based on section 8 status or posting no section 8 advertisements. Tenants who qualify for the section 8 program pay 30 of their income toward rent and the federal government pays the rest.

Under sb 329 and sb 222 all landlords in california will be required to accept section 8 and vash vouchers and other forms of rental assistance and to consider them as part of an applicant s income.

However landlords are still posting no. Gavin newsom on tuesday signed a bill that will make it illegal to reject a prospective tenant solely based on the applicant s use of a section 8 federal housing voucher. Governor signs mandatory section 8 bill.
Holly mitchell d los angeles will ban blanket policies against taking section 8 applicants and require landlords to treat voucher holders like any other applicant. Sb 329 redefines source of income as lawful verifiable income paid directly to a tenant or to a representative of a tenant or paid to a housing owner or landlord on behalf of a tenant including federal state or local public assistance and. The assistance is generally known as section 8 housing though the law applies to other programs as well.
